Resume writing tips for Customer Relationship Managers
- Use job-specific titles that match posting requirements exactly, avoiding creative variations that confuse applicant tracking systems and hiring managers scanning for Customer Relationship Manager candidates.
- Lead your professional summary with years of CRM experience and quantified achievements, positioning yourself strategically against job requirements rather than burying critical qualifications in later sections.
- Start bullet points with impact-driven action verbs followed by specific metrics, transforming generic responsibility lists into compelling evidence of customer retention and revenue generation success.
- Replace vague interpersonal skills with measurable relationship outcomes like client presentation success rates, database management improvements, and documented conflict resolution results that demonstrate real business value.

Resume summaries for Customer Relationship Managers
A strong customer relationship manager summary shows more than qualifications; it shows direct relevance to the role. Your summary serves as strategic positioning, immediately connecting your background to what employers need. This isn't just listing skills; it's demonstrating how your experience translates to their specific challenges and goals.
Most job descriptions require that a Customer Relationship Manager has a certain amount of experience. That means this isn't a detail to bury. Lead with your years of experience, quantify achievements with specific metrics, and highlight relevant industry knowledge. Focus on aligning your proven results with their requirements.

Try the Resume BuilderResume bullets for Customer Relationship Managers
Customer Relationship Manager resumes get scanned quickly. If your bullets don't show clear value and outcomes fast, they'll get passed over. Most job descriptions signal they want to see customer relationship managers with resume bullet points that show ownership, drive, and impact, not just list responsibilities.
Lead with your biggest wins and make the impact instantly clear. Start bullets with strong action verbs like "increased," "retained," or "generated" followed by specific numbers. Instead of "managed customer accounts," write "retained 95% of high-value accounts worth $2M annually." Put your most impressive metrics first.

How to format a Customer Relationship Manager skills section
- Replace "excellent communication skills" with specific metrics like "delivered 60+ client presentations, securing 92% contract renewal rate."
- Quantify CRM platform expertise by stating "managed Salesforce database with 15,000+ contacts, improving data accuracy by 40%."
- Transform "problem-solving abilities" into measurable conflict resolution scenarios showing satisfied clients and retained business relationships.
- Demonstrate analytical capabilities through concrete results like "identified customer trends that generated 28% revenue increase within six months."
- Showcase leadership experience by mentioning team sizes managed, training programs delivered, or successful cross-departmental project coordination achievements.

Resume FAQs for Customer Relationship Managers
How long should I make my Customer Relationship Manager resume?
In 2025, hiring managers in customer relationship management spend an average of 7.3 seconds scanning each resume. For Customer Relationship Manager positions, a one-page resume is ideal for professionals with under 10 years of experience, while two pages are acceptable for senior-level candidates with extensive client success stories. This length constraint forces you to prioritize recent achievements in client retention, relationship building, and revenue growth. Use space wisely. Highlight quantifiable results like "Increased client retention by 32%" rather than listing routine responsibilities. Remember that conciseness demonstrates your ability to communicate effectively - a critical skill for any CRM professional.
What is the best way to format a Customer Relationship Manager resume?
Hiring managers evaluating Customer Relationship Manager candidates typically look for organized professionals who can balance analytical skills with relationship-building capabilities. A reverse-chronological format works best, clearly showcasing your progression in managing client relationships. Begin with a targeted professional summary that highlights your client retention rate and relationship management philosophy. Include dedicated sections for CRM software proficiency (Salesforce, HubSpot, Microsoft Dynamics), client success metrics, and communication skills. Use clean, consistent formatting with bullet points for achievements. Keep it simple. This structure allows recruiters to quickly identify your ability to nurture client relationships while delivering measurable business outcomes.
What certifications should I include on my Customer Relationship Manager resume?
The market for Customer Relationship Manager talent in 2025 increasingly values specialized certifications that demonstrate both technical and strategic capabilities. The Certified Customer Experience Professional (CCXP) certification has become particularly valuable, showing your ability to design client journeys and measure satisfaction. Additionally, platform-specific certifications like Salesforce Certified Administrator or HubSpot CRM Certification demonstrate technical proficiency with tools you'll use daily. For those focusing on data-driven relationship management, the Customer Analytics Certification is increasingly sought after. List these credentials prominently near your name and contact information, as they immediately signal your commitment to professional development and industry standards.
What are the most common resume mistakes to avoid as a Customer Relationship Manager?
Customer Relationship Manager resumes often fall short by focusing too heavily on activities rather than outcomes. The most prevalent mistake is listing generic responsibilities ("managed client relationships") instead of quantifiable achievements ("increased client retention by 28% through personalized outreach strategies"). Another common pitfall is neglecting to showcase CRM technology proficiency, which is now fundamental to the role. Many candidates also fail to demonstrate their communication skills through the resume itself. Fix this. Incorporate specific metrics around client satisfaction, retention rates, and revenue growth. Include examples of relationship-building strategies that delivered business results. Remember that your resume should model the clear, strategic communication you'll bring to client relationships.
